From: Mateusz Nosek <mateusznosek0@gmail.com>

Previously 0 was assigned to variable 'error'
but the variable was never read before reassignemnt later.
So the assignment can be removed.

Signed-off-by: Mateusz Nosek <mateusznosek0@gmail.com>
---
 mm/shmem.c | 9 +++------
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/mm/shmem.c b/mm/shmem.c
index 31b4bcc95f17..84eb14f5509c 100644
--- a/mm/shmem.c
+++ b/mm/shmem.c
@@ -3116,12 +3116,9 @@ static int shmem_symlink(struct inode *dir, struct dentry *dentry, const char *s
 
 	error = security_inode_init_security(inode, dir, &dentry->d_name,
 					     shmem_initxattrs, NULL);
-	if (error) {
-		if (error != -EOPNOTSUPP) {
-			iput(inode);
-			return error;
-		}
-		error = 0;
+	if (error && error != -EOPNOTSUPP) {
+		iput(inode);
+		return error;
 	}
 
 	inode->i_size = len-1;
-- 
2.17.1
